Since starting our group in December 2023 we have organised a wide range of trips to the theatre, concerts, cinema and exhibitions. Our group members have a wide, diverse range of interests taking us to everything from the Adult Panto at the Royal Court through to Verdi’s Requiem at the Liverpool Anglican Cathedral and Beyond Van Gogh at the Liverpool Exhibition Centre.
Although we have a core group of members that attend many of our trips, we welcome everyone into the group as they join us for a show, play, film or concert that they really want to see. We are lucky to have a wonderful range of art and culture venues in Liverpool, so we do all we can to bring people together to enjoy these.
Our trips include both matinee and evening performances and are often accompanied by a lunch or pre-theatre dinner for all those who wish to join. We like to make our outings as social as possible, so ensure that an invite for food is extended to all that can make it.
